Western Refining, Inc.
WNR shares are down nearly 5% today, losing 91 cents to $17.78, a loss of 4.87% after competitor Valero
VLO reported earnings this morning.
Valero reported earnings of 79 cents per share on revenues of $26.3 billion. This blew away Wall Street estimates of $21.6 billion in revenues.
Volume in Western Refining is about average today, as 3.2 million shares have changed hands today, versus the average daily volume of around 4 million shares.
Western Refining, Inc., through its subsidiaries, operates as an independent crude oil refiner and marketer of refined products in Texas, Arizona, New Mexico, Utah, Colorado, and the Mid-Atlantic region.
